English: Old railway bridges, Leicester. A pair of old railway bridges across the River Soar in Leicester. The bridge further away from the camera, at a slightly higher level than the one in front, carried the main line of the Great Central Railway southwards out of Leicester, heading towards Rugby, Aylesbury and London's Marylebone terminus. The slightly lower bridge, closer to the camera, carried trains into and out of a goods yard. |
